I usually apply gesso to the underside of illustration board so it won't warp so much.. and I got some plywood so I can pre-stretch watercolour paper if I need to. I'd hate to ruin the pretty edges of Arches by doing that, though.. so I'll try to get a heavier paper if at all possible. Thanks again! Big Smile
